For your convenience, we've compiled information regarding fixed-wing and helicopter landing access at each of our properties. Helicopter landings often require pre-authorization from the pilot for safety and logistical reasons.
Here's a quick overview:
Fairview House (Plettenberg Bay): Fixed-wing aircraft can land directly. For helicopter landings on the lawn, pre-authorization is required.
Fugitives' Drift Lodge: The nearest airstrip for fixed-wing aircraft is in Vryheid. Helicopters can land adjacent to the guesthouse, subject to pilot pre-authorization.
Leopard Mountain Lodge: Fixed-wing aircraft can utilize the airstrips at Mkuze or Phinda. Helicopter landings are permissible within the reserve, pending pilot pre-authorization.
Makakatana Bay Lodge: The Hluhluwe Airstrip is available for fixed-wing aircraft. Helicopters can land near the lodge, with pilot pre-authorization required.
Three Tree Hill Lodge: Fixed-wing aircraft can land at LadySmith. Helicopter landings are possible at the lodge, contingent upon pilot pre-authorization.
Sungulwane Lodge: Fixed-wing aircraft can use the Phinda or, if necessary, the Mkuze airstrip. Helicopter landings are permitted within the reserve, subject to pilot pre-authorization.
